Verdict
There has to be a doubt over whether Duke Of Lucca retains all his ability after a long time off. Open Hearted stopped quickly at Warwick on his reappearance and was pulled up. Brody Bleu is having his first run since June but Galway Jack is a previous winner here and has a chance if putting in a clear round. ARDEA, who won a maiden at Hexham last April, has been in terrific form between the flags recently and has only failed once when ridden by Joe Wright. He gets the nod ahead of fellow recent point-to-point winner One Conemara, though Nowurhurlin will have benefited from a spin around Kelso.
